Danish Dough

Ingredients

  • COLD WATER 32 oz.
  • YEAST 5 oz.
  • BREAD FLOUR 4#
  • CAKE FLOUR 1#
  • DRY MILK SOLIDS - sifted 4 oz. SALT 1 oz.
  • SUGAR 12 oz.
  • BUTTER - well softened 12 oz.
  • EGGS 16 oz.
  • CARDAMOM 2 tsp.
  • BAKERS MARGARINE or BUTTER - roll-in 2 # 8 oz.

Preparation

Step 1

METHOD: STRAIGHT DOUGH MIXING METHOD
1. DOUGH: Mix the first 10 ingredients together - "Straight Dough Mixing Method". Mix on low speed for " 3 minutes" until a smooth loose dough is formed - do not overwork the dough! Relax 15 minutes. Spread the dough onto a well-floured parchment lined sheetpan, and retard for 30 minutes.
2. BUTTER BLOCK: Spread evenly over 2/3 of a parchment lined sheetpan. Place in the refrigerate just before the dough is finished relaxing.
3. When both the butter and dough have reached the same consistency, place the dough onto a well-floured work table, brush-off excess flour and cover 2/3rds of the dough evenly with the butter block.
4. Fold into 3rds to complete the LOCK-IN. Turn 90 degrees.
5. Roll out the dough to a rectangle about 1/2" thick (no thinner). Complete the 1st 3-FOLD, then refrigerate 30 minutes.
6. Complete the 2nd 3-FOLD, refrigerate 30 minutes, and the final 3rd 3-FOLD (total of 135 layers). Wrap tightly and refrigerate. Use the 2nd day.
GUIDELINES FOR DANISH MAKEUP:
1. Shape into danish, relax 10 minutes, indent, fill, finish proofing.
2. Whole egg wash applied before filling.
3. 3/4 Proof total.
4. Bake @ 375 F.
5. Glaze while hot. Allow to cool and then apply fondant.
